If I had anything to add, it would be that it be written with the non-ice dancer (free style skaters, round'n'round skaters, hockey players, ankle skaters, those who don't skate) in mind that rinks, pros, ice dancers could use to encourage more into ice dancing. Problem for the decrease in social ice dancing is due to several things: 1. no mention of ice dancing lessons or what ice dancing is. 2. many pros do not have an ice dancing background hence, they do not look to teach it. 3. Rinks, when boys/men come in and show an interest is buying skates, they are shown hockey skates. Same happens with rentals. 4a. Watching better ice dancers (anyone who does ice dancing at any level) ice dance makes it look like it is beyond a prospective ice dancer's ability. Same for watching high-end competitions on tv 5. Seldom are ice dancers on public sessions helping skaters and introducing them to the simple dances.

Social ice dance sessions do exist today
- JoAnn's article makes it sound like social ice dance sessions are a thing of the past but I had recently heard from at least 11 of them that are happening on a weekly basis. I believe that social ice dance sessions can currently be found in Boston, Chichago, SF, Wilmington DE, Cincinnati, Minneapolis, Portland OR, Vancouver BC, Toronto, Washington DC and I know that we have a good one here in NYC. The number of social ice dance sessions currently happening is small but the number is not zero so please don't make the situation sound worse than it really is!
